Highest Education Level

Quality Assistants in Maine offer the following education background
Bachelor's Degree
36.4%
High School or GED
17.4%
Master's Degree
16.7%
Associate's Degree
14.0%
Vocational Degree or Certification
11.2%
Doctorate Degree
2.1%
Some College
1.6%
Some High School
0.6%
